  • UNCHAINED: The SEC Thinks Crypto Airdrops Are Securities. Here's Why This Lawyer Thinks It's Wrong
    Sep 20 2024

    Congressmen Tom Emmer and Patrick McHenry sent the SEC a letter demanding clarification on how crypto airdrops are securities offerings. Amanda Tuminelli of the DeFi Education Fund breaks down why she thinks the SEC is wrong on its interpretation.


    This week, Republican Representatives Tom Emmer and Patrick McHenry sent a letter pressing SEC Chair Gary Gensler for clarity on how securities laws apply to airdrops.

    With billions of dollars worth of tokens airdropped this year alone, projects need clarity more than ever.

    In this episode, Amanda Tuminelli, Chief Legal Officer of the DeFi Education Fund, dissects the SEC’s stance on airdrops, why her organization believes the SEC has stretched the legal definition of “compensation” too far, and what Congress might ask Gensler in his upcoming hearing.

    Plus, she talks about how the SEC “regrets” any confusion it caused for using the term “crypto assets securities,” since the agency now admits that tokens themselves are not securities.

  • THE MINING POD: Hut 8’s Bitmain Partnership, Bhutan’s $700m Bitcoin Bags, RFK Jr.’s Mining Letter, Trump’s Bitcoin Burger
    Sep 20 2024

    Colin and Matt cover a motley of news items including Hut 8’s U3S21EXPH partnership with Bitmain, Bhutan’s fat bitcoin stacks, why Robert F. Kennedy Jr. is bullish on bitcoin mining, and Trump’s historic bitcoin purchase.

    Welcome back to The Mining Pod! For this week’s news roundup, the crew dives into Hut 8’s partnership with Bitmain on the manufacturer’s new hydro-cooled ASIC model, the U3S21EXPH. Matt also gives everyone a geography lesson with his overview of Bhutan and its hoard of 13,011 BTC worth $780 million, the fourth largest BTC reserve of any nation, and Colin covers Robert F. Kennedy Jr.’s letter to the editor in the Economist in which he defends Bitcoin mining for its utility as a flexible load for renewable energy. Plus, a former President, a bitcoin mining CEO, and a pub owner walk into a bar, and everyone leaves with a burger paid in bitcoin (yes, every outlet has covered this story, but we are too). And finally in this week’s cry corner, the unfortunate story of a Norwegian town whose residents will pay more for power after a bitcoin mine ceased operations.

  • COINDESK DAILY: Could We Still See a Crypto Bill This Year?; FTX’s Accounting Firm to Pay SEC $1.95M in Settlements
    Sep 18 2024

    Host Jennifer Sanasie breaks down the news in the crypto industry from the possibility of a crypto bill this year to FTX accounting firm's settlement with the SEC.

    "CoinDesk Daily" host Jennifer Sanasie breaks down the biggest headlines in the crypto industry today, as Rep. Patrick McHenry and Sen. Cynthia Lummis maintain their position that a chance remains for a crypto bill to clear Congress before the end of the year. Plus, FTX accounting firm Prager Metis agrees to pay $1.95 million in settlement to the SEC, and CFTC Chair Behnam speaks on the legal battle against Kalshi.
